About the role
Join us to own regulatory and safety compliance for our radio remote control systems for industrial machinery. You’ll bridge functional safety, RF/electronics, design, and certification, partnering with R&D and external labs from early design through certification and market surveillance.
What you’ll do
Regulatory & Product Compliance
Lead product compliance for radio remote controls (EU & global).
Interpret/apply: EU RED (2014/53/EU), Machinery Regulation (EU) 2023/1230, EMC, LVD / EN 62368‑1, and market approvals (e.g., FCC, IC, MIC, SRRC, ANATEL).
Prepare/maintain Declarations of Conformity (DoC) and technical files.
Functional Safety
Support compliance to EN ISO 13849‑1/-2
Contribute to safety concepts (safety functions/architectures, PL/SIL justification, FMEA, FMEDA, MTTFd, DCavg, B10d).
Support safety validation, documentation and audits.
Laboratory Testing & Certification
Plan/coordinate/witness testing: RF (EN 300 220 / EN 301 489 / FCC Part 15), EMC, electrical safety, environmental, and functional safety validation.
Interface with external labs, Notified Bodies/ExCB, and certification partners; review test plans/reports and drive corrective actions.
Documentation & Quality
Maintain structured technical files; ensure traceability Requirements → Design → Tests → Certificates.
Support internal/external audits
